How far is Charleston, West Virginia from Kannapolis?

The distance from Charleston, West Virginia to Kannapolis is 205.5 miles (330.7 km) as the crow flies. Kannapolis is located SSE of Charleston, West Virginia. By car, the driving distance is approximately 256.9 miles, taking about 5h 10min. A direct flight would take roughly 55min. Both are located in United States — Charleston, West Virginia in West Virginia and Kannapolis in North Carolina.
